Finally the much talked about films, Gangs Of Wasseypur And Teri Meri Kahaani released this Friday. Both films have managed to gain much publicity recently. That is exactly why the opening response they received is a tad disappointing. If we go by the opening day responses of these films it seems neither will fare well at the box office.

Gangs Of Wasseypur managed the western viewers to sit up and take notice. The film however failed to impress the Indian crowd. The occupancy rate of Gangs Of Wasseypur across the country did not exceed 10 to 15 percent. Recent films like Shanghai and Ferrai Ki Sawaari managed to draw a greater number of people on their respective opening days. The film has been applauded by the critics but the general mass remain unimpressed.

The other Bollywood flick which hit the theaters this week was Shahid Kapoor and Priyanka Chopra starrer Teri Meri Kahaani. This film had a conventional and commercial script, cast and music. Still the Kunal Kohli movie failed to attract the audience to the theatres. The film had a marginally better opening than Gangs Of Wasseypur but that cannot be called impressive either. The occupancy rate in multiplexes for this reincarnation flick was about 30-35 percent. Shahid’s last unsuccessful film Mausam had managed to get a better opening than Teri Meri Kahaani. Much had been expected from the film which was directed by none other than Kunal Kohli. The Shahid and Priyanka chemistry failed to work it’s magic this time it appears. Critics are not very happy with the film either calling it predictable and run of the mill stuff.

The weekends will obviously see a rise in the occupancy rate for both the films. Even that will not be able to save either of the two films. It seems that the much awaited films has failed to strike a chord with the audiences.
